Q: How do environmental conditions affect a microscope? A: Excessive heat, moisture, or dust can damage optical and mechanical components, so the microscope should be used in a clean, controlled environment. Q: Can a microscope capture images or videos? A: Many modern microscope models include digital cameras that enable high-resolution image and video capture for documentation or analysis. Q: What training is required to operate a microscope? A: Basic understanding of optics and focusing principles is recommended, though most educational microscopes are designed for simple, intuitive use. Q: Why is regular maintenance important for a microscope? A: Regular maintenance prevents dust buildup, mechanical wear, and misalignment, ensuring consistent performance and image clarity. Q: Can a microscope be used outside the laboratory? A: Portable and handheld microscope models are available for field studies, allowing researchers to observe and analyze samples on site.
